Azure Log Analytics agent for Windows SHA-2 signing date has been extended

Target availability: Q3 2020

The Azure Log Analytics agent for Windows will begin to use SHA-2 signing exclusively on Aug. 17, 2020. This change requires action only if you’re running the agent on a legacy OS version.

Azure Virtual Network NAT now generally available in Azure Government and Azure China

NOW AVAILABLE

Azure Virtual Network NAT (network address translation) simplifies outbound-only Internet connectivity for virtual networks and is now generally available in the Azure Government and Azure China regions. NAT can be configured for one or more subnets of a virtual network and provides on-demand connectivity for virtual machines.

New Azure VMware Solution is now in preview

IN PREVIEW

The new Azure VMware Solution is a first party Microsoft Azure Compute service that enables customers to run VMware natively on Azure. The new service is directly operated, delivered and supported by Microsoft, and is endorsed by VMware through a direct cloud provider partnership agreement.
